what was the original audience for movies like this? were there b-movie houses?
- dave 12-13-2013 9:15 pm [add a comment]


Drive-ins maybe.
- jimlouis 12-13-2013 10:03 pm [add a comment]


i guess drive-ins is correct as well as grindhouse theaters in major metropolitan areas were the primary purveyors. also, there was the creation of midnight movies in more traditional venues along with the movies being "presented as special events by traveling roadshow promoters ." and lastly, perhaps, the blanket saturation of releases we see now (which itself may have been a marketing ploy cribbed from early 70s horror movies) allowed for some of the tamer fare (?) early on to be packaged as b-movie double features. i can only imagine that as tv eroded the moviegoing numbers that there were theaters eager for whatever might turn a profit.
